Fox 101.9’s Fifi, Fev & Nick has hit the airwaves in a new campaign that reinforces the trio’s strong connections with the hearts and minds of Melburnians. 

The Fox 101.9 campaign features a catchy jingle that is bound to become an earworm around the city as it bounces across the screen karaoke-style, Fifi, Fev & Nick are “Your mates on radio, it’s Melbourne’s favourite show.” 

The commercial shows a series of the Breakfast Show team’s best and most loved moments in vignettes, such as Fifi as the Moomba Queen, breaking a Guinness World Record for the longest marathon for a radio music show at 27 hours, the famous singles nights parties, and Fev’s Guinness World Record mark.  

The bespoke jingle was created by Fifi, Fev & Nick’s executive producer Leon Sjogren, with sound production by the Hit Network’s famous David Konsky, aka DJ Konsky.

Nikki Clarkson, SCA chief marketing officer, said: “The jingle was the basis of the idea, along with the development of three new and lovable animated characters of Fifi Box, Brendan Fevola and Nick Cody.

“The aim of the campaign is to ensure the creative is reflective of Melbourne’s no. 1 Breakfast show. It’s distinctive and different from the usual radio approach and we guarantee Melburnians will be singing along before they know it.”

The Fox campaign will run on free TV, BVOD, socials and cinema throughout the year. 

Earlier this year, Fifi, Fev & Nick have successfully broken the Guinness World Record for the longest marathon for a radio music show DJ (team).

The team was under very strict rules from on-air talking, music, ads and content, but their efforts were rewarded after completing the record just after 9am.

Among some of the efforts the Box, Fevola and Cody, and Shala used to stay up included exercise equipment such as a stationary bike, pilates reformer and dance parties during music breaks.
